This position will serve as the Division 10 Traffic Engineer for the Division Traffic Engineering and Traffic Services Units responsible for the maintenance operation and installation of signs pavement markings and traffic signals. This position will perform and review traffic engineering studies for speed limits new traffic signals intersection improvements crosswalks and other various requests. The scope of these studies includes but are not limited to data collection crash analysis use of various software tools such as Synchro MMS ArcGIS and SAP coordination with local governments elected officials and the general public regarding the implementation of any needed improvements or new infrastructure. This position will review and improve any special event requests. This position will review and make recommendations for traffic engineering items as prepared for upcoming transportation projects to include traffic forecasts corridor plans pavement marking plans signal plans and traffic control plans. This position must be able to communicate clearly with city and county officials school officials developers corporate management and the general public about traffic engineering issues. This position will oversee the administration of purchase order contracts and annual maintenance budgets. This position will review traffic impact studies and analysis for District Offices to ensure proper mitigations are being recommended for development impacts to our roadway system. This position will meet with Districts PEFs and developers on their studies and recommendations.

Bachelors degree in an applicable field of engineering from an appropriately accredited institution and four (4) years of progressively responsible experience including two (2) years of supervisory experience; or an equivalent combination of education and experience. Necessary Special Qualification: May require registration as a professional engineer by the North Carolina Board of Examiners for Engineers and Surveyors.
